Output dfc6f51ac073fe3a12ef963b63d58500d9442619f10ef1385ceeeb5abe4eaf1e:56

value
5206443
script pubkey
OP_0 OP_PUSHBYTES_20 c35942e57d649742532c359d7285bbbed425b34e
address
bc1qcdv59etavjt5y5evxkwh9pdmhm2ztv6w5xxxw2
transaction
dfc6f51ac073fe3a12ef963b63d58500d9442619f10ef1385ceeeb5abe4eaf1e
spent
true